Understand the Manufacturer’s Certifications and Compliance
The initial step in your investigation requires you to verify the manufacturer’s comp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) standards. GMP-certified facilities enforce stringent standards for production processes, cleanliness practices, and quality control measures, which result in consistent product delivery and safe product distribution. Many reputable manufacturers also operate FDA-registered facilities and may carry NSF, ISO, or HACCP certifications.
A trustworthy dietary supplement manufacturer should be transparent about its certifications and willing to provide documentation upon request. These certifications demonstrate that the company maintains industry-standard quality requirements while executing approved manufacturing methods.
The lack of appropriate compliance measures exposes your business to product recalls, legal liabilities, and customer dissatisfaction, which leads to harm to your business image.
Evaluate Ingredient Sourcing and Transparency

The supplement quality you produce depends entirely on the quality of your raw material components. Manufacturers should provide their ingredient sourcing information and their testing protocols used to measure product purity and contamination levels.
Reputable supplement manufacturing companies establish partnerships with trusted vendors while creating comprehensive documentation systems that enable them to trace their product ingredients from origin to final delivery. Some manufacturers even provide global ingredient traceability systems while supplying Certificates of Analysis (COAs) which cover both their raw materials and their completed products.
The supplement industry requires businesses to operate with complete transparency because consumers today know more about product ingredients, dangerous metal contamination, and deceptive product labeling.
Manufacturers should demonstrate their operational practices through public disclosure of information related to:
- Where ingredients come from
- Independent testing
- How allergens are managed
- Products that meet either non-GMO or organic standards
- Methods used to test product stability
Your brand establishes consumer trust through this level of openness.
Check Their Product Testing Procedures
Testing serves as the essential element that determines the success of supplement production. Reputable manufacturers need to perform various testing procedures throughout their entire production process. This process includes testing of raw materials, ongoing production tests, and final product tests.
The leading manufacturers of today employ cutting-edge laboratory systems to test their products for potency, purity, and safety. Some facilities also perform quality assurance through their own HPLC and ICP-MS testing capabilities.
Before investing, ask about:
- Microbial testing
- Heavy metal screening
- Identity verification
- Shelf-life testing
- Batch consistency checks
A reliable dietary supplement manufacturer will have documented testing protocols and clear quality-control procedures in place.
Review Manufacturing Capabilities
Different supplement brands require different dosage formats and packaging solutions. Some manufacturers specialize only in capsules, whereas others provide powders, gummies, tablets, liquids, stick packs, and softgels.
Choose a manufacturer that can support your current product needs and future expansion plans. Full-service supplement manufacturing services often provide:
-Custom formulation
-Flavor development
-Packaging design
-Labeling support
-Private labeling
-Fulfillment services
Manufacturers’ flexible production capabilities help your business achieve efficient growth as demand increases.
Ask About Minimum Order Quantities
Minimum order quantities have a major impact on both your initial business expenses and your stock management processes. Certain manufacturers demand that their clients produce extremely high quantities, which creates difficulties for brands that operate at smaller or developing stages.
Many current dietary supplement manufacturing businesses provide low minimum order quantity production services to support new and developing enterprises.
The following elements should be used to assess manufacturers:
-Initial production requirements
-Cost per unit
-Storage capabilities
-Reorder flexibility
-Lead times
The financial danger that exists in your start-up phase of business operations will decrease when you work with a manufacturer that provides flexible production solutions.
Understand Regulatory and Labeling Support

The process of making supplementary regulations work becomes difficult when businesses begin to sell their products through online platforms and worldwide distribution channels. The labeling process and health claims that lack proper support lead to problems with regulatory compliance.
Modern supplement manufacturing services include regulatory support, which helps manufacturers produce their products according to established labeling standards and documentation requirements.
The support package contains the following components:
-Development of Supplement Facts panels
-Evaluation of ingredient compliance
-Process for verifying claims
-Documentation needed for export purposes
-Complete evaluation of product labels
The need for regulatory support has grown stronger because online marketplaces and retailers established stricter supplement compliance requirements for their operations in 2026. Industry discussions also show that platforms like Amazon are increasing scrutiny around testing documentation and label accuracy.
The process of working with an experienced manufacturer will help you prevent expensive errors that occur during compliance maintenance.
